Benefits of Using Dryer Balls

Reduced Drying Time

Dryer balls accelerate the drying process by separating clothes and allowing air to circulate more efficiently. This results in significant time savings, reducing energy consumption and potentially lowering utility bills.

Softened Fabrics

Dryer balls act as natural fabric softeners, eliminating the need for harsh chemicals. They gently massage fabrics, reducing wrinkles and creating a noticeably softer feel.

Increased Fluffiness

Dryer balls help to fluff up fabrics, restoring their volume and giving them a fresh, revitalized appearance. Towels, blankets, and other bulky items benefit greatly from this effect.

Usage of Dryer Balls

Number of Balls

The optimal number of dryer balls depends on the size of your dryer and the amount of laundry being dried. Generally, 3-6 balls are sufficient for a standard-sized dryer.

Placement

Place dryer balls into the dryer along with your wet laundry. They will tumble freely throughout the drying cycle.

Drying Cycle

Use dryer balls on all types of drying cycles, including regular, delicate, and air-dry. They are compatible with both electric and gas dryers.

Maintenance

Dryer balls require minimal maintenance. Occasionally remove any lint or debris that may accumulate on them. They can be reused multiple times without losing their effectiveness.

Types of Dryer Balls

Dryer balls come in various materials, including wool, plastic, rubber, and silicone. Choose the type that best suits your needs and preferences.

Answers to Your Most Common Questions

Q: How long do dryer balls last?
A: Dryer balls can last for several years with proper care.

Q: Can dryer balls be used with dryer sheets?
A: Yes, but it is not recommended. Dryer sheets can leave a residue on dryer balls, reducing their effectiveness.
